Output da4e8dcfae79a129ce888d52525eaa99aece42cc94e92dbf7f1c003253fdb91a:3

value
18004044
script pubkey
OP_0 OP_PUSHBYTES_32 38e1e2ecce46062ca0e252a2eba2073455fd5939bc9a51255d9da56a1c9fde88
address
bc1q8rs79mxwgcrzeg8z223whgs8x32l6kfehjd9zf2ankjk58ylm6yqfvyvjh
transaction
da4e8dcfae79a129ce888d52525eaa99aece42cc94e92dbf7f1c003253fdb91a
confirmations
276992
spent
true